Are people in Beloit older or younger than people in Charlotte?- The Median Age in Beloit is 1.0 years younger than in Charlotte.
Are housing costs cheaper in Beloit or Charlotte?- Beloit
housing costs are 62.2% less expensive than Charlotte hous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Beloit or Charlotte?- The average commute for residents of Beloit is 3.3 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Charlotte.
